Born on February 26, 1900, in Dresden, Germany, Fritz Wiessner developed an desire in climbing all through his youth. He speedily turned fascinated because of the sandstone cliffs of Saxony, a location well-known for its demanding climbing traditions and rigid moral requirements. These early activities taught him the necessity of balance, precision, and self-reliance, expertise that might outline his amazing job.

During the twenties, Wiessner recognized himself as considered one of Germany's very best climbers by completing several tough very first ascents. His capacity to clear up elaborate climbing problems and deal with complicated rock formations gained him common recognition within just the eu climbing Neighborhood. Not like a lot of his contemporaries, he thought that climbing must count primarily on natural motion as an alternative to excessive artificial aids, a philosophy that expected many rules of contemporary free climbing.

In 1929, Wiessner emigrated to The us, where by he played a vital job in building American rock climbing. He launched Highly developed European climbing strategies to North American climbers, noticeably raising specialized criteria. Throughout the subsequent a long time, he accomplished quite a few to start with ascents within the Shawangunk Ridge of New York, New Hampshire's White Mountains, and also other critical climbing parts. Quite a few of those routes stay classics and remain climbed by lovers nowadays.

Wiessner's influence reached significantly over and above rock climbing. He became deeply linked to Himalayan mountaineering through a time period when many of the environment's maximum peaks remained unclimbed. His most well-known expedition arrived in 1939 when he led an American team trying K2, the planet's 2nd-highest mountain. Inspite of restricted machines and tough climatic conditions, Wiessner climbed to an elevation of around 8,380 meters, coming remarkably near to achieving the summit. Even though the K2 expedition finally finished without a summit and became surrounded by controversy as a result of tragic gatherings in the descent, modern day historians identify Wiessner's remarkable accomplishment. His climbing capacity, leadership, and dedication below Intense situations had been many years forward of their time. Many experts feel that, beneath marginally much more favorable instances, he may possibly have grown to be the first man or woman to summit K2.

Past his climbing achievements, Wiessner was a passionate Instructor and mentor. He shared his in depth know-how with younger climbers, encouraging specialized excellence, very careful preparation, and respect for mountain environments. His affect aided condition the event of climbing organizations and security techniques throughout The us.

Wiessner also championed ethical climbing. He emphasized minimizing using synthetic devices and thought that climbers should count on skill, judgment, and physical capability Every time attainable. These Concepts assisted lay the foundation for contemporary free climbing ethics and continue to guide climbers around the globe.
